This 12 scale re issued Tamiya kit is the next large scale model car that I will build, I may substitute the XF-16 that Tamiya recommend for the Alclad II Aluminium. This kit first appeared back in the '70's and has a workable steering and suspension system, the only addition Tamiya have included to update the kit is the large photo etched sheet and the drivers harness, as this is a re-issue the plastic molding has been produced in the Philippines, all of Tamiya's kit that are re-issued after a long absence have all corresponding identification details removed from the sprue.
This model measures 38.1cm in length when finished.
